eGospodarka.pl
eGospodarka.pl poleca

eGospodarka.plGrupypl.comp.programmingkwestia estetycznaRe: kwestia estetyczna
  • Data: 2011-08-12 19:08:54
    Temat: Re: kwestia estetyczna
    Od: "slawek" <s...@h...pl> szukaj wiadomości tego autora
    [ pokaż wszystkie nagłówki ]


    Uzytkownik "A.L." <l...@a...com> napisal w wiadomosci grup
    dyskusyjnych:ed70475rcne7dblito7dr9lcir4b165g6c@4ax.
    com...
    > Owszem. To bylo bardzo dawno. Sam osobiscie, w GWBASIC napisalem
    > program skladajacy sie z ciurka prawie 10 tysiecy linii. Ale GWBASIC
    > nie mial procedur.

    Jestes pewien, ze nie mial GOSUB/RETURN ? ;)

    Tu masz manual http://www.o-bizz.de/qbtuts/gw-train/index.htm#5

    > Nawet w COBOLU i Fortranie czasy 100 stronicowych procedur dawno
    > minely.

    Mylisz sie. Jest taki program w Fortranie, obrzydliwy, ponad 1000 linii
    ciurkiem, bez procedur. Pisal autentyczny Chinczyk, utalentowany. Uzywane to
    jest do Bardzo Powaznych Rzeczy. Syf. Nikt (kto troche sie zna na
    programowaniu) nie chce sie tego ruszac. A styl ma taki:

    write(6,2143)
    read(5,99) a(1,1)
    write(6,2144)
    read(5,99) a(1,2)
    ...

    Jakbys nie zgadl, to powyzej masz czytanie macierzy a, o rozmiarze 10x10, z
    "promptami" w rodzaju "a(1,1) = ?" .

    Tak, w ten prosty sposób w programie jest 3x10x10 linijek, czyli 900 linii -
    i to na czytanie jednej macierzy. A jest jeszcze druga taka ;)

    Z drugiej strony "obliczenia" które program robi, to pare operacji na
    tensorach, daloby sie zwiezle zapisac. Lecz do skumania co to za tensory
    itd. - potrzeba wgryzc sie gleboko. Nikomu nie chce sie przez pól roku
    siedziec nad takim debilstwem. Przynajmniej mi sie nie chcialo. Wiec to cudo
    (napisane juz w tym tysiacleciu) ma sie dobrze.

    > Problem zas generalny jest taki ze "miszcze porogramowania" uwazaja ze
    > obiektowosc oferowana pzrez jezyki to tylko triki programistyczne
    > ulatwiajace (a raczej na ogol gmatwajace) pisanie kodu. Mysia zas
    > ciagle tymi samymi kategoriami ktorymi myslalo sie w czasach GWBASICa.

    Jest gorzej. Jemzyki LoLoPe daja im mozliwosc paprania znacznie lepiej, niz
    do tej pory mogli to robic w GWBASIC i BASICA.


Podziel się

Poleć ten post znajomemu poleć

Wydrukuj ten post drukuj


Następne wpisy z tego wątku

Najnowsze wątki z tej grupy


Najnowsze wątki

Szukaj w grupach

Eksperci egospodarka.pl

1 1 1

Wpisz nazwę miasta, dla którego chcesz znaleźć jednostkę ZUS.

Wzory dokumentów

Bezpłatne wzory dokumentów i formularzy.
Wyszukaj i pobierz za darmo: